EVGA launches the GTX 1070 TI FTW Ultra Silent, specifications

The well-known assembler EVGA has launched the  GTX 1070 TI FTW Ultra Silent, a high-end graphics card that features a fully customized design and is based on NVIDIA’s GP104-300 graphics core .

Externally the GTX 1070 TI Ftw Ultra Silent stands out for having a very voluminous dissipation system that allows you to maintain very good working temperatures. Its huge aluminum radiator and its two large ACX 3.0 fans work together to keep the card fresh at all times.

In the back we find a metal plate that helps cool and also reinforces the structure of the card, essential considering its size and the weight that the PCB must support when it is installed.

We continue talking about the PCB and we find a completely customized construction, which highlights the 10 + 2 phase power system and the two 8-pin power connectors, enough to guarantee a good margin of overclock although the card comes from the factory at stock frequencies.

The GTX 1070 TI FTW Ultra Silent occupies three expansion slots , something that you must take into account if space on your PC is scarce, and has been announced with an official price of $ 499, a figure that could translate into something more than 500 euros in Spain.

Otherwise it has all the key specifications of a GTX 1070 TI standard; 2,432 shaders , 152 texturing units, 64 rasterized units, 256-bit bus with 8 GB of 8 GHz GDDR5 and 1,607 MHz-1,683 MHz GPU.
